What Does the Name Daniel Mean?

Daniel is a name of Hebrew origin that traditionally means “God is my judge.” It has been popular for centuries and appears in religious texts, historical records, and modern cultures around the world.
The name remains one of the most widely recognized personal names globally.

Why does Daniel have different spellings?
Languages adapt names to fit local pronunciation rules, writing systems, and cultural traditions.

Are Daniel and Daniele the same name?
Yes. Daniele is an Italian variation of Daniel and shares the same origin and meaning.
